Todays conversation is a podcast version of my Seminar from the Camden Wellness Expo where I riffed on my top 5 Pillars of Great Gut Health!

This is real deal stuff, not fancy probiotics, gut cleanses, special broths of juices. Before that. The foundations of great gut health.

#1: Chew Well

#2: Only eat when your actually hungry

#3: Mindful eating

#4: Avoid over eating

#5: Eat a variety of Fruit and Veg, atleast 5 serves per day
